DELICIOUS SAUCY CARROTS
This is a great side dish that my mom used to make all the time. Typical Czech cuisine. We serve it with pasta or potatoes and chicken breast. I make this quite often as my DH loves it. Sometimes I add baby pea for more color. It is easy put together and delicious inexpensive meal.

Steps:
- In large sauce pan put carrots, water, chicken cube, salt and sugar.
- Cover and bring to boil. When starts to boil lower the heat and let it simmer until carrots is soft but still has a shape about 25min.
- When carrots is almost cooked make your roux.
- In a small sauce pan melt butter add flour and cook for 2-3min. don't let it brown. Stir with wooden spoon all the time. Slowly add this flour mixture - roux to cooked simmering carrots. Stir well.
- Let it cook for another 5min. Turn of the heat add vinegar it will bring out more flavor.
- Taste if needs more salt or sugar.
- Serve as a side dish with boiled potatoes or pasta and meat of your choice.
